Admission Requirements

Academic Requirements

A minimum of a lower second-class honours degree is usually required. Applicants should be able to demonstrate appropriate teaching experience in language education (typically at least 1-2 years) and/or a pre-service certificate (Cambridge CELTA/Trinity Cert. TESOL or equivalent). Non-native English speakers will require an English level of IELTS 6.5 (or equivalent), with a minimum of 6.0 in all sub-scores.
